    Heh. Sorry for forgetting to say I've solved the mystery.

    It's Shelter (2010), starring Julianne Moore and Jonathan Rhys Myers. It's one of those intriguing premises that failed to come through, but it has its moments.

    I watched it because it was written by Michael Cooney, a Brit who wrote Identity (2003), an almost traditional murder mystery with a twist, and The I Inside (2003), an odd little psychological thriller-mystery film.
